Key Performance Characteristics to Look for in Gel Nail Products

Understanding the performance characteristics of Gel Nail products is one of the things that comes into play for selecting the best. It is such important knowledge that you will need to achieve beautiful, long-lasting results with the application. One of them is the viscosity, or thickness, of the gel. A gel polish should be thick enough to allow for even application but not entirely thick and will allow for flexibility and durability. Gels that are too thick may lead to a cumbersome application process; too runny can leave uneven layers and mixed finishes.

Another performance parameter to be considered is the pigmentation of the gel polish. Deeply pigmented gels are way better with fewer coats because they literally save time while giving a good overall durability of the manicure as well. This is very important for professional nail technicians and anyone who tries to give efficient yet good services to customers. Another significant aspect is the curing time of the gel. A less curing time means more productivity for nail salons as they can serve more customers in record time without compromising quality.

Stability is another important performance characteristic. Gel polishes create a poor application result due to separate or thickening over time. Resistance to chipping and fading is also to be looked at. The high-end gel nail products should hold their color vibrant and the gloss for quite a time duration so that the use can enjoy beautiful manicured nails for weeks. Focusing on these important features ensures one opens up the beautiful gel polishes to stunning nail designs that would last long.

Best Practices for Applying and Removing Gel Polish Effectively

When gelling goes on, its right application and removal become paramount to let you achieve exquisite results and keep your nails healthy. Preparation of the nails is thus the first step. The cleaning of the nail surface, cuticle pushing back, and a light buffing of the nails provides the desired smooth base. The nail resurfacer gives the base coat an improved adhesion to the nail and a longer wear of gel polish. Thin layers should always be applied; this allows an even cure with lowered chances of any lifting or chipping.

An equally important part of the gel polish application procedure is its removal. Under no circumstances should gel polish be peeled off. Doing so would weaken the already weak natural nail. The right way to proceed is to soak cotton rounds in pure acetone and place them over each nail, wrapping the foil securely enough so that it can hold in all of the heat. After about 10 minutes, the gel polish should become soft enough for you to remove it with either a wooden stick or a specially designed nail tool. To help restore hydration and prevent dryness of the surrounding skin & nails, you should replenish nail oil or skin moisturizer after removing gel polish. By following these good practices, you not only make your manicure last longer but also contribute to your nails' general well-being.

The Role of UV and LED Light in Gel Polish Curing Processes

Curing is an integral part of the gel polish application process. And knowing the functions of both UV and LED light is just important to get a great finish that lasts. When applied, gel polish will stay in that semi-liquid state much longer and requires the presence of special red and blue wavelengths to cure it to harden into a long-lasting finish. The UV lamp has a defined range of spectra. This property of the lamp proves effective in activating the photoinitiators present in gel complex compositions for curing. Unfortunately, UV lamps dry polishes slower and are a big turnoff for fast service clients.

However, the LED lamps are preferred for their efficiency in curing the gel polish. They give light in a considerably narrow targeted area from 365nm to 405nm wavelengths, allowing a faster course for accelerated polymerization. Thus, under LED light, gel polish can cure within 30 seconds: a shorter time making the application process speedier, much convenient, and more enjoyable both to the nail technicians and clients. LED lights are also long-lasting, energy-efficient, and thus, more eco-friendly.

Both UV and LED would serve the same purpose, but the users should take heed of the type of gel polish they are using since not all gels can cure under both types of lights. Buyers must look into each product's specifications before purchasing to optimize the outcomes. Learning on these differences would definitely make the entire nail experience better and also extension to its life, hence more satisfying with the end result.

Exploring the Latest Trends and Innovations in Gel Polish Technology

Innovation and consumer preferences have propelled the gel polish industry into a whirlwind of change lately. A report from Grand View Research notes that the global gel nail polish market worth in 2022 was around $1.4 billion and is expected to increase at a compound annual growth rate of 8.4% from 2023 to 2030. The tremendous growth rate is indicative of much more than the rising trends of gel polishes; it also reflects the advancements and innovation present in the technicality of manufacturing and in enhancing users' experiences.

One of the forefronts of gel polish technology is the emergence of ecological formulation. Consumers growingly concerned about what goes into their beauty products have pushed manufacturers to create gel polishes free of toxic ingredients, such as toluene, dibutyl phthalate (DBP), and formaldehyde. Reports suggest that brands promoting "five-free" and even "ten-free" have begun to draw substantial clout in the eyes of health-conscious buyers seeking less toxic alternatives without performance compromises.

Innovations in curing technology have changed the application of gel polish. The new LED lamps fastened the process with efficiency, also enabling a wider range of shades and finishes of gel polish. Allied Market Research's data says that salons are on the vergeof being boom with LED technologies, with approximately 60% of nail salons expected to convert from UV to LED curing systems by the year 2025. This is indeed a big win not just in terms of time and efficiency but also protects the skin of the higher risk of exposure to UV rays.
